Interesting to read all the opinions on us being unable to reinvest transfer fees received. There is one way to do this though and that is to introduce a 'loan transfer fee'. This amount would be paid to the loaning club and equate to the salary that ITFC might otherwise be paying to the player during his loan.

Transfer fees are not included in the salary cap and the loan player is still contracted to the loaning club so I would say that clubs could make as many of these deals as they want since they won't be paying salaries for the player loaned. Within the Champ I would imagine that there might be quite a number of players who could replace Downes available on loan and maybe even one or two with more experience.
